易语言是一种中文编程语言,它简单易学,但在某些方面可能不如Python功能强大,为了充分发挥Python的优势,我们可以在易语言中调用Python插件,如何实现这一功能呢?以下就是具体的操作步骤和注意事项。
我们需要确保已经安装了Python环境,在易语言中调用Python插件,实际上就是通过易语言的“执行程序”命令来运行Python脚本,以下是详细的步骤:
1、准备Python脚本:
在开始之前,你需要编写一个Python脚本,这个脚本将实现你想要的功能,我们可以编写一个简单的Python脚本“test.py”,内容如下:
print("Hello, this is a Python script!")
2、安装Python插件:
在易语言中,我们需要安装一个名为“Python插件”的模块,这个模块可以让易语言调用Python脚本,安装方法如下:
(1)打开易语言,点击菜单栏的“工具”→“模块管理”;
(2)在弹出的“模块管理”窗口中,点击“添加”按钮;
(3)选择“Python插件”模块,点击“打开”;
(4)在弹出的对话框中,点击“安装”按钮。
3、在易语言中调用Python脚本:
安装好Python插件后,我们就可以在易语言中调用Python脚本了,具体步骤如下:
(1)在易语言中新建一个模块,命名为“调用Python示例”;
(2)在模块中添加一个子程序,命名为“调用Python”;
(3)在子程序中添加以下代码:
.版本 2
.程序集 程序集1
.子程序 调用Python
.局部变量 python脚本, 文本型
.局部变量 返回值, 整数型
python脚本 = "test.py" 'Python脚本文件名
返回值 = 执行程序("python", python脚本, "", 0)
这段代码中,我们使用了“执行程序”命令来调用Python解释器,运行指定的Python脚本。
4、运行和调试:
完成上述步骤后,我们就可以运行易语言程序了,如果一切正常,程序会调用Python脚本,并在控制台输出“Hello, this is a Python script!”。
以下是一些注意事项:
- 确保Python环境变量已配置正确,在命令行中输入“python”命令,如果能够进入Python交互模式,说明环境变量配置正确;
- 在调用Python脚本时,确保Python脚本文件的路径正确,如果脚本不在易语言程序的同一路径下,需要使用绝对路径或相对路径;
- 调用Python脚本时,可以传递参数,在“执行程序”命令的参数中,添加需要的参数即可。
通过以上步骤,我们就可以在易语言中成功调用Python插件了,这样,我们可以充分利用Python的强大功能,为易语言程序增色添彩,以下是一些进阶技巧:
- 可以在Python脚本中导入其他模块,实现更复杂的功能;
- 可以在易语言和Python之间进行数据交换,例如通过文件、数据库或网络;
- 可以根据需要,将易语言和Python的优势结合起来,开发出功能更强大的应用程序。
掌握在易语言中调用Python插件的方法,将有助于我们更好地利用两种编程语言的优势,提高编程效率,实现更多有趣的功能,希望以上内容能对您有所帮助。